why does a piece of metal feel cooler than a piece of wood at the same temperature?
multiple choice
metals lose heat rapidly and becomes cooler than wood.
wood is always at a higher temperature than metals because it is an insulator.
wood holds more heat because of air in the spaces where cells once existed.
you sense heat flowing from your body as cool, and metal is a better conductor than wood.

Explanation:

Brief Explanations

When you touch a material, your body senses heat flow. Metals are good conductors of heat. So, heat flows more readily from your body (which is at a higher temperature than the room - temperature objects) to the metal. Wood is a poor conductor (insulator). So, less heat flows from your body to the wood. The sensation of heat flowing away from your body is perceived as "cool".

Answer:

You sense heat flowing from your body as cool, and metal is a better conductor than wood.
